Sea breeze, Salty air and Tranquility - A Motorcycle trip to Varkala

You know life is good when last minute plans become the best adventures you can have. We had to go on a family trip along with my parents to Banglore for 2 days. The trip got cancelled due to some unforeseen circumstances. Suddenly I thought why not plan a trip to Varkala as our previous month’s plan got cancelled at the last moment. So me and my wife decided to take the bike. We started looking for stays at Varkala and planned the itinerary for 2 nights stay. The plan was to leave as early as possible to avoid traffic in Kerala.

Day 0
I removed the grab handles and fixed the luggage rack back on the motorcycle. Cleaned the chain and washed the bike in the morning. Let the bike and chain air dry for few hours and then adjusted chain slack, lubed the chain and checked the tyre pressure. Packed our luggage in my Viaterra Claw Mini and essentials in Tank Bag.

Day 1, Sep 7th.
We started from our home at 5 Am in the morning. Reached Traveloungue, Walayar around 6 am for our first stop. We had a coffee and a cheese cake break.

We resumed our journey towards Varkala. Filled the bike in a petrol bunk and planned to stop for a coffee break after an hour. On the outskirts of Kochi, google asked us to take a diversion and took us through less crowded routes. The roads were excellent but narrow and too many diversions. With not many options for food amd refreshment, we just took a water and stretch break. After another hour of riding, we stopped at a random hotel around 10.30 am to have our breakfast. It was getting very hot and humid. We stopped again around 12 pm for a tender coconut break.

We reached our stay at Varkala around 2.30 Pm. Our stay Point Break surf and stay, was located at Edava beach just behind the aquarium which is a lesser crowded beach. The room was a small but adequately sized room with a cozy ambience and clean washrooms. We were given a welcome drink.

After refreshing, we went to Cafe Sarwaa on the south cliff to have our Lunch. The food was good with an excellent view of the beach from the cliff.

We then returned back to our rooms, parked the bike and went to Edava Beach which is just 100 metres away from the stay. We spent some time watching the Sun set from the beach and then proceeded to explore the North Cliff. Wife was busy shopping souvenirs to give back home. We had dinner at Dargeeling Cafe and returned to our room for the night.

Day 2, Sep 8th.
We had slight changes in our Itinerary. We had planned to visit Jatayu Earth Centre, but shifted it to Day 3 because I wanted to return via Shencotta, Kovilpatti, Madurai route as I could visit my Grandparents at Tenkasi and have lunch break there. So we woke up late around 9 am. Had breakfast from the room and went to beach to spend some time. Went to lunch at Cafe Trip is Life. Had lunch with some amazing views of the beach.

We then came to rooms, got changed and went to Mangrove Village for our Sunset Kayaking. Kayaking experience was fun and adventurous. It was a 3.5 km Kayaking trip of 2.30 hours. We Kayaked through the mangrove forest and reached a spot where we could get down into the water and have some fun. Since we didnt bring any change of clothes, we just dipped our legs into the water. While returning, we went through mangrove tunnels. It started pouring while returning to the starting point. We then returned to our rooms, changed our clothes and went to Cafe God’s own country for dinner. The food there was just average but the live music was very good. Spent some time there and returned to our rooms.

Day 3 and 4, Sep 9 and 10.
Got up to a gloomy morning with on and off rains. Got ready, had our breakfast, checked out of the room by 10am and we were on our way home. Our first stop was at Jatayu Earth Centre. We reached there around 11.30 am. The cable car experience was pretty good and the sculpture and views were great. Had some buttermilk and kulukki sharbhat and resumed our journey towards my grandparents’ home. We reached Tenkasi around 2.45 pm, got ourselves refreshed and had our lunch. We then decided to stay there for the night as wife was feeling a bit tired and also I wanted to avoid driving at night. Next morning we started around 5 am and reached back home with some stretch and breakfast breaks around 11.30 am.
